Module: VagrantPlugins::Ventriloquist::Cap::Linux::NvmInstall

Defined in:
lib/ventriloquist/cap/platforms/linux/nvm_install.rb

Class Method Summary collapse

Class Method Details

.nvm_install(machine) ⇒ Object



6
7
8
9
10
11
# File 'lib/ventriloquist/cap/platforms/linux/nvm_install.rb', line 6

def self.nvm_install(machine)
  if ! machine.communicate.test('test -d $HOME/.nvm')
    machine.env.ui.info('Installing NVM')
    machine.communicate.execute('\curl -L https://github.com/creationix/nvm/raw/master/install.sh | sh')
  end
end